Volunteers at Humphreys Park (Local News ~ 05/06/16)
Volunteers Richard Kaiser, Tim Tucker, John Cotter and Bob Evans were hard at work Friday at Humphreys Park in Linton, moving the children's playground from its location near the front of the park to a new spot where the horseshoe pits once stood. "This new location will be safer for the kids, away from the highway," said Kaiser. "This area up front will be the farmer's market," added Kaiser... -
Twin Rivers construction program to hold open house May 13 (Local News ~ 05/06/16)
The Twin Rivers Construction Technology Program has built a new home for it's 2015-2016 school year project. The home is located just north of Wendy's in Linton, on 4th Street. An open house is planned for Friday, May 13, from noon to 8 p.m., and the public is invited and encouraged to attend... -

WRV prepares students for middle school transition (Local News ~ 05/06/16)
The current White River Valley Lyons Elementary hosted the first pep session to introduce students to what is going to be the WRV middle school on Friday afternoon. Assistant principal Jimmy Beasley welcomed the students and told them about the activities that they would be doing for the day, which included a wide variety of games run by teachers, a scavenger hunt and meeting with the teachers that will be instructing the students when the middle school opens next year... -
